Abu Dhabi Commercial Bank’s Six Sigma Approach

Introduction

The corporate world has relentlessly been at the forefront of the fight to find a lasting solution to the current economic challenges. This has led to numerous inventions in forms and patterns of management, leading to the successful invention of the six sigma management strategy. This strategy was developed by the international telecommunication giant Motorola in the mid 1980s. However, its popularity grew a decade later, and in 1995, Jack Welch made this strategy his centre of focus, and from there, the strategy is widely put in use in many other industries today. The main agenda in the six sigma strategy is to identify and enhance the quality of output procedures by minimizing the level of errors, ultimately reducing the company’s vulnerability.

This strategy engages a number of quality checks and management methods following defined steps to ensure quality output and minimal errors. In simpler terms, the six sigma strategy can be defined as a way of reaching perfection, a discipline driven approach to avert any instances of faulty circumstances in an organization. My focus will be in the successful Abu Dhabi commercial bank in the United Arab Emirates. Formed and founded 32 years ago as a limited liability company, the Abu Dhabi was a public shareholding company. The majority of shares are held by the Abu Dhabi government. The rest are owned by other institutions and individuals.

The government owns about 65% of the total shares, while the rest are distributed to the public. The bank is one of the largest in the country in terms of the overall shareholding and market value (Dahlgaard, Kristensen and Kanji). The company engages in a number of financial services including retail, commercial, investment, brokerage, merchant, fund management and many other financial services (Dahlgaard, Kristensen and Kanji). The structures put in place in a six sigma business strategy are aimed at the following objectives. First and foremost, six sigma is aimed at improving the functioning processes and lowering the possibility of defects in the company. Then there is the other function of reducing the operating processes variability as well as reducing costs. These objectives finally add up to more beneficial and advantageous situation where the consumers are well catered for and as a result consumer confidence rises proportionally (Anthony and Govindarajan).

This then leads to an accumulative profit and increased returns propelling the company’s financial stability hence success. Six sigma is more concerned on how far a production process can deviate from the perfection (Anthony and Govindarajan). The argument in this business strategic process is that when one knows the possible number of defects expected in a function of a certain process, then it is easy to determine and find ways of eliminating the defects. The perfection notion comes in since a defective process leaves a perfect process in place.

As it can be noted, the six sigma strategy is composed of three key elements which are customers, processes and employees. The customer is more concerned with the quality of goods he or she is getting from his purchases. They expect to purchase reliable products at competitive and pocket friendly prices. Secondly, the process, on the other hand, is the procedures of production. The quality of any product is measured by how far it can satisfy the customers’ needs (Anthony and Govindarajan). The customer’s point of view is supreme and the process must act in response to the customer requirements. This includes comprehending the customers’ requirements and needs in terms of their feelings and preferences. This allows the management to identify the point of disparity and change effectively in favor of the customers’ advantage hence move closer to the main objective which is perfection.

The third element of this strategy is the employees who are the main drivers of productivity. Growth opportunities and attractive remuneration can be offered to employees to help encourage talent exploitation and maximum focus on the job. Incentive given to employees motives them to offer all of their attention to the job and hence help in quality production. Six Sigma Implementation

The Abu Dhabi bank has adopted the six sigma strategic management concept and is reaping benefits already. In the sequential process, the bank first identified and developed new process of in banking. The bank is credited with revolutionizing the banking industry with unbeatable products such as loaning facilities and money transfer. Taking into account how far the services offered by the bank are effective goes along way in changing the business’ strategic management. The bank ensures it reaches and matches up to the global strategic benchmarks in order to compete with global institutions. In the six sigma implementation process, the bank has been striving to surpass its customers’ expectations.

This is achieved by researching the changes in preferences and change in market structures that necessitates a shift in the way the bank operates. The bank has succeeded in creating in making quality services its organizational culture. Offering quality services has the benefit of eliminating the possible errors hence living up to the intended spirit of the six sigma concept. The Abu Dhabi bank took the challenge and organized for a training seminar to train its employees on how to conceptualize the use of Six Sigma. By so doing the company increased its customers’ satisfaction. Sealing the loopholes where loses are incurred the bank dealt with the most imperfection in its operations as required by the six sigma concept.
